People with weak fingers or wrists ought to look for giant, comfy, delicate handles with grips or loops that accommodate all your fingers so you should utilize your whole hand to apply power shears, and a spring-loaded mechanism so the shears open by themselves. Solid building and good stability, with few crevices where meals can accumulate. Smooth action, the shears ought to open and close with little effort. Handles ought to match your hand comfortably. If they're too small, they'll scale back your control and drive.

They should be non-slip - plastic or rubber handles tend to be greatest for this - in any other case it may be difficult to use drive when slicing chicken bones or different powerful material. A bone notch on one blade helps grip poultry bones or flower stems for simpler slicing. A lock is useful on spring-loaded models to hold the blades safely closed. A tightening mechanism, akin to a bolt, may help keep the blades closely aligned. Blades ought to be nicely-aligned and sharp - however don't test together with your fingers! Ensure they meet cleanly as you close them. Short blades could make reducing harder as you can't get an extended stroke. Pull-apart shears that separate into two elements for straightforward cleaning. Other optional options can include bottle and jar openers, a nutcracker, herb stripper, or screwdriver head. Store them in a knife block or wrapped in a cloth or sheath, to guard the blades. Don't put them in a dishwasher, some are labelled as dishwasher secure, however even then, hand cleaning might be preferable. Good-high quality blades can be resharpened with a steel or by an expert.
